You can now throw ducks in the river! It looks like the water is going down again today

Toti Toronell takes to the streets with his most “naïve” clown, taking advantage of everyday elements to transform the public’s gaze and invite them to see the world with tenderness, care and awareness. With clowning, circus, ceramics, music, painting, dance, screen printing, sculpture, drawing and theatre, he takes us on a unique journey through the disciplines he has explored over the years, intertwining improvisation and prepared numbers, creating a confusion in which you never know if the disasters are part of the script or if they are really happening.

Meet the company

Toti Toronell is a clown, creator and stage researcher, trained through self-taught work and learning from key figures in clowning and contemporary theatre such as Avner (The Eccentric), Jango Edwards, Leo Bassi or Comediants.

After directing and acting with Cop de Clown (1995–2006) and founding Laitrum Teatre as a space for pedagogical research, he began his own path with the Toti Toronell Company where circus, visual theatre, objects, music and plastic arts converge.
